There are 4 doors leading to a temple. A man goes to temple every day and places 2 flowers under the statue of god. But to reach the temple he has to cross 4 doors. On each door there is one guard and he takes bribe before letting one pass that door. each guard takes one more than half of the total flower available with the devotee. How many flowers the man takes with him every day?

  1. 60

  2. 62

  3. 30

  4. 32

B Correct answer
Explanation

Work backwards: the devotee has 2 flowers after the 4th door. Before door 4: (2+1)*2 = 6. Before door 3: (6+1)*2 = 14. Before door 2: (14+1)*2 = 30. Before door 1: (30+1)*2 = 62. Verification: 62→31 (31 taken), 31→15.5→16 (16 taken), 16→8 (8 taken), 8→4 (4 taken), 4→2 (2 taken) leaves 2.
